Multi-spectral photometric stereo can recover pixel-wise surface normal from a single RGB image.The difficulty lies in that the intensity in each channel Fan Shop - NCAA - Clothing is the tangle of illumination, albedo and camera response; thus, an initial estimate of the normal is required in optimization-based solutions.In this paper, we propose to make a rough depth estimation using the deep convolutional neural network (CNN) instead of using depth sensors or binocular stereo devices.Since high-resolution ground-truth data is expensive Speaker Accessories to obtain, we designed a network and trained it with rendered images of synthetic 3D objects.
We use the model to predict initial normal of real-world objects and iteratively optimize the fine-scale geometry in the multi-spectral photometric stereo framework.The experimental results illustrate the improvement of the proposed method compared with existing methods.
